Iīve been vaping with a VaporDoc vaporizer for like two months and i love vaping, so decided iīd get a Volcano.

Well, my Volcano arrived yesterday. Dialed it to 9, when it reached itīs temperature (yellow light off) turned on the air pump (green light) and kept it blowing hot air for 30 minutes, as if it were a new heat gun.

Included instructions donīt say anything about cleaning herbīs chamber or valve before first use, but i like to clean every new single piece i plan to inhale/smoke from, so i ran hot water through both pieces, then iso alcohol, then hot water again. Shaked both pieces till they were perfectly dry. Fitted included bag and i was ready for my first bag

Grinded a small widow nugget and placed it on the herb chamber. Attached bag, put knob at 6.5 and when bag was filled inhaled it. It wasnīt as smooth as expected, so checked herbīs chamber. It was quite brownish, so for next bag knob was at 4.5. This time the vapor was thinner and cleaner. Inhaled. and felt the relaxing effects of herbs.

I was ready, third bag there i go! Everything was easier this time, i was getting used to operate it. Grinded another lickle nugg and placed it, attached bag, press green button, wait. While i was waiting, noticed huge vapor leaks. Shit, what was happening? Checked and realised i forgot to attach chamberīs second screen this time.
